Crispy Chicken Milanese with Tomato Salad: Ingredients List
Okay, let’s get down to the good stuff! Here’s what you’ll need to make this amazing **crispy chicken milanese with tomato salad**. I always lay out all my ingredients before I start cooking—it’s the best way to keep things chill and organized. Trust me, it makes the whole process so much smoother!
For the Crispy Chicken Milanese
- Chicken Breasts: About 2 large, boneless, skinless chicken breasts. I like them because they’re easy to work with.
- Breadcrumbs: 1 cup of plain breadcrumbs. You can use panko for extra crunch, but regular breadcrumbs work great too!
- Parmesan Cheese: 1/2 cup, finely grated. Freshly grated is best, but pre-grated works in a pinch.
- Eggs: 2 large eggs. These are for the egg wash, which helps the breadcrumbs stick.
- Flour: 1/2 cup all-purpose flour. This helps the breading adhere to the chicken.
- Olive Oil: Enough for shallow frying, about 1/2 inch in your skillet. Use a good quality olive oil for the best flavor.
Ingredients for the Fresh Tomato Salad
- Tomatoes: 2-3 ripe, juicy tomatoes, sliced. I usually go for whatever looks best at the store.
- Red Onion: 1/4 of a small red onion, thinly sliced.
- Basil: A handful of fresh basil leaves, roughly chopped. Fresh basil is a must!
- Balsamic Vinegar: 2 tablespoons. This adds a nice tang.
- Salt and Pepper: To taste. Don’t be shy with the seasoning!
Step-by-Step Instructions: How to Prepare Your Crispy Chicken Milanese with Tomato Salad
Alright, let’s get cooking! This **crispy chicken milanese with tomato salad** is surprisingly easy, and I’ll walk you through every single step. Don’t worry, you got this! Just take it one step at a time, and you’ll be enjoying a delicious meal in no time.
Preparing the Chicken: The First Step to Crispy Chicken Milanese
First things first, let’s get those chicken breasts ready. You’ll want to pound them to an even thickness. I usually put each breast between two sheets of plastic wrap and use a meat mallet (or even a rolling pin!) to gently flatten them. This helps them cook evenly and makes them extra tender. You want them about 1/4-inch thick, give or take.
Building Your Breading Station
Next up: the breading station! This is where the magic happens. Grab three shallow dishes. In the first, put your flour. In the second, whisk your eggs with a fork until they’re nice and frothy – that’s your egg wash! And in the third, mix your breadcrumbs and Parmesan cheese. Make sure everything is easily accessible, and you’re ready to go. It’s like an assembly line, but for delish!
Breading and Frying the Chicken
Now, for the fun part: breading and frying! First, dredge each chicken breast in the flour, making sure to coat both sides. Then, dip it in the egg wash, letting any excess drip off. Finally, coat it generously with the breadcrumb mixture, pressing gently to make sure it sticks. Place the breaded chicken on a plate, ready for frying. Don’t worry if it gets a little messy—it’s part of the fun!
Frying to Golden Perfection
Heat your ol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. You’ll know it’s ready when a breadcrumb sizzles immediately when you drop it in (careful, it splatters!). Carefully place the breaded chicken in the hot oil, making sure not to overcrowd the pan. Cook for about 3-4 minutes per side, or until the chicken is golden brown and cooked through. Always check the internal temperature to make sure it reaches 165°F (74°C). Remove the chicken and place it on a plate lined with paper towels to drain any excess oil.
Making the Fresh Tomato Salad
While the chicken is frying, let’s make that refreshing tomato salad! Slice your tomatoes and red onion. In a bowl, combine the tomatoes, red onion, and fresh basil. Drizzle with balsamic vinegar, and season generously with salt and pepper. Give it a gentle toss, and you’re good to go. The simplicity is key here, and the flavors are just perfect together!
Assembling Your Crispy Chicken Milanese Simple Dinner
And there you have it! To serve, simply place a piece of crispy chicken on a plate and top it with a generous portion of the fresh tomato salad. You can add a squeeze of lemon juice over the chicken or add a side of pasta or roasted vegetables to complete your **crispy chicken milanese simple dinner**. Enjoy!

Achieving Perfectly **Crispy Chicken**
The key to super **crispy chicken** is all about the breading and the frying. Make sure your oil is hot enough before you add the chicken—you want that sizzle! Don’t overcrowd the pan, either. Cook in batches if you need to, so the chicken gets nice and golden and doesn’t steam. Also, pat the chicken dry before breading; this helps the breadcrumbs stick and get extra crunchy!

Storage and Reheating Instructions
So, you’ve got leftovers? Awesome! This **crispy chicken milanese** is just as good the next day, if not better! Store leftover chicken and salad separately in airtight containers in the fridge. The chicken will stay crispy for a day or two, but the salad is best eaten within a day.
To reheat the chicken, I usually pop it in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es, or until heated through. You can also quickly reheat it in a skillet over medium heat, but watch it closely so it doesn’t burn. For the salad, just give it a toss and enjoy it cold! Yum!
